Charla is now offering Neuro vision rehab services. Neuro vision rehab targets and treats visual-processing deficits beyond refractory or age-related changes addressed by an optometrist. Individuals with a neurological conditions including concussion, TBI, stroke, or neurodegenerative disease often experience vision changes, and they are frequently under recognized or addressed. Neuro vision deficits are broad and can include challenges with eye motor control, double vision, neglect (spatial inattention), and other visual processing disorders. With 40 hours of training specifically on neuro vision rehab, Charla has the advanced skills needed to treat vision dysfunction in adults and enable optimal performance in meaningful daily activities.
